Infrastructure Solutions Architect for Elections - Financial – Legal Support
The Infrastructure Solutions Architect will perform a combination of both Infrastructure and Application Architect responsibilities related to MDOS Elections, Financial, and Legal departments. The Infrastructure Solutions Architect will also lead the efforts of those performing Business Analyst duties and executing tasks as defined in the State of Michigans Project Management Methodology (PMM) as well as the Systems Engineering Methodology (SEM).
Specific tasks may include but are not limited to:
• Analyze and recommend architecture solutions
• Lead developers in development of system in accordance with defined architecture.
• Ensure compliance with standards (defacto and dejure)
• Analyze and recommend architecture solutions for Web and mobile applications
• In a Lead Role analyze business practices and processes to determine infrastructure best practice strategies to ensure maximum effectiveness and efficiency.
• Assist with Strategic planning, including applications integration and legacy application strategy
• Analyze hardware and software to assist in the standards determination and setting of processes
• Perform Cost analysis and modeling to assist in the assessment of the return on investment for projects and computer operations.
• Analyze application development processes and tools to support architecture/infrastructure at SOM.
• Recommend changes in hardware, storage, network systems, operating systems, COTS software, security and software design to meet future growth and improve system performance. All recommendations are to be approved by SOM.
• Assist with the development of Business Process Models through the architecture/infrastructure lens.
• Assist with architecting the integration of various vendor technologies including COTS
• Support technical teams with architecture/infrastructure implementations
• Assist with the coordination of architectural change in both technical and business environments
• Assist with architecting diverse solutions into a cohesive and manageable environment
• Recommend solutions for technical architectures of web content management applications
• Assist in the development of solution architectures from business requirements, information architecture, and technical architecture
• Analyze market trends so as to relate business needs with technical opportunities.
• Participate in technology infrastructure test plan development and execution
• Create and modify appropriate documentation deliverables that exist within the Systems Engineering Methodology and are required for the State of Michigan standards.
• Lead and review BA efforts and gathering for completeness for infrastructure efforts.
Were looking for an individual that serves as the communication bridge between non-technical business users and technical solution developers. The Solutions Architect should demonstrate a depth of knowledge in business analysis and design processes including knowledge of methodology, tools, and techniques. This individual is an active participant in aspects of department assessment, visioning, and reengineering.
